description Product Description

Used as a key intermediate in the synthesis of pharmaceutical compounds, particularly in the development of antithyroid and antimicrobial agents. It serves as a ligand in coordination chemistry for forming metal complexes with biological activity. Also employed in the preparation of heterocyclic compounds for agrochemicals and dyes. Its derivatives show potential in medicinal chemistry due to their enzyme inhibitory properties.
